Ir al contenido principal

[Recepción de pedidos - GCW] Flujos y estados de pedidos - Cómo funciona

Juliana Maciel Maruri da Cunha avatar
Escrito por Juliana Maciel Maruri da Cunha
Actualizado hace más de 3 semanas

Resumen del proceso de pedido

No importa cómo se envíen los pedidos, todos siguen el mismo proceso principal dentro de GelatoConnect:

1. Envío del pedido

Los pedidos pueden llegar al sistema por diferentes vías:

  • Envío por API: Los pedidos se envían mediante solicitudes POST. El sistema comprueba que el formato de la solicitud sea correcto y devuelve un ID de pedido.

  • Envío desde tu tienda online: Los pedidos realizados a través de plataformas de comercio electrónico conectadas se importan automáticamente.

  • Envío por FTP: Los archivos de los pedidos se suben y se revisan cada cierto tiempo, luego se convierten en pedidos.

  • Envío directo desde la plataforma: Las integraciones (por ejemplo, Cloudprinter, Redbubble) envían los pedidos ya formateados directamente a GelatoConnect.

2. Validación y procesamiento inicial

Una vez recibidos, los pedidos pasan por:

  • Validación de datos: Revisa que todo esté completo, bien formateado, con referencias de clientes y los identificadores únicos de producto.

  • Validación de archivos de impresión: Se verifican las URL de los archivos y se comprueba que sean compatibles, que tengan la resolución y dimensiones adecuadas, y que las fuentes estén incrustadas.

  • Validación de reglas de negocio: Incluye comprobaciones sobre restricciones de envío, disponibilidad, cantidades y requisitos para envíos internacionales.


Cambios en el estado del pedido

Los pedidos en GelatoConnect pasan por varios estados a lo largo de su ciclo de vida:

Estados iniciales

  • Borrador: El pedido se ha guardado, pero aún no se ha enviado.

  • Recibido: El pedido se ha enviado a GelatoConnect.

  • Completado: El pedido ha superado todas las comprobaciones.

  • Error: El pedido no pasó la validación.

  • Creado: El pedido ha pasado la validación y está listo para producción.

Estados de producción

  • En producción: Tu pedido está en marcha.

  • Impreso: Tu pedido ya está listo.

  • Empaquetado: El pedido está listo para salir hacia su destino.

Estados de envío

  • Enviado: El pedido ya ha salido de nuestras instalaciones.

  • En camino: Tu pedido va de viaje.

  • Entregado: El pedido ha llegado a manos del cliente.

  • Devuelto: El pedido fue devuelto.

Estados de error

  • Error: No se pudo validar o procesar la información.

  • Cancelado: El pedido fue cancelado.


Eventos y notificaciones

  • Eventos del sistema: Todos los cambios de estado se registran internamente.

  • Notificaciones externas: Los clientes reciben avisos a través de postbacks, correos electrónicos y eventos de Webhook.

  • Actualizaciones de estado de la API: Puedes consultar el estado usando las APIs Get Order y Search Orders.


Motivos habituales de fallo en pedidos y cómo solucionarlos

GelatoConnect te da motivos concretos cuando algo falla para que puedas solucionarlo fácilmente.

"Sin conexión"

Qué significa: El producto en Storefronts no está vinculado a una especificación de GelatoConnect.
Solución:

  • Ve a Storefronts, busca el producto y haz clic en Conectar producto.

  • Sube los archivos de diseño si los necesitas.

  • Completa la conexión y vuelve a enviar el pedido.

"Envío no disponible"

Qué significa: El transportista no puede entregar en la dirección indicada.
Solución:

  • Valida la dirección y el país admitido.

  • Piensa en otras formas de envío.

  • En los pedidos de la API, utiliza métodos de envío separados por comas en shipmentMethodUid.

Descargas de archivos fallidas

Qué significa: No se puede acceder a las URLs de los archivos de impresión.
Solución:

  • Asegúrate de que las URLs sean públicas y válidas.

  • Asegúrate de que las URLs estén bien formateadas para servicios como Dropbox, Google Drive u OneDrive.

Problemas de formato de archivo y calidad

Qué significa: Los archivos no cumplen con las especificaciones de producción.
Solución:

  • Utiliza la resolución adecuada (normalmente 300 DPI).

  • Incluye sangrado (normalmente 3 mm).

  • Utiliza el color CMYK e incrusta todas las fuentes.

Identificación de producto no válida

¿Qué significa?: El UID del producto o el producto personalizado del cliente no es válido o no se reconoce.
Solución:

  • Verifica que el productUid, el productName y el productVariant sean exactamente correctos.

  • Utiliza búsquedas para encontrar los códigos de producto que coincidan.

Precios de venta al público no disponibles (pedidos internacionales)

Qué significa: Faltan los datos de precios de aduanas.
Solución:

  • Incluye retailCurrency, retailShippingPriceInclVat y items[i].retailPriceInclVat en la solicitud de la API.

Fallos de autenticación de la API

Qué significa: Las credenciales de la API no son válidas.
Solución:

  • Verifica tu clave y tu secreto.

  • Asegúrate de que los encabezados tengan el formato correcto.

  • Usa HTTPS.


Cómo solucionar problemas cuando un pedido falla

  1. Consulta el estado y el motivo del fallo
    Ve a Workflow > Order Intake > Manage Orders, abre el pedido que ha fallado y consulta el motivo del fallo.

  2. Revisa las solicitudes de la API (si corresponde)
    En Workflow > Order Intake > Requests, revisa los detalles de solicitud y respuesta del pedido.

  3. Aplica la solución adecuada
    Sigue las indicaciones de arriba para solucionar el problema.

  4. Vuelve a enviar el pedido
    Una vez corregido, vuelve a enviarlo o crea un nuevo pedido.

  5. Supervisa con Postbacks
    Configura postbacks para recibir actualizaciones de estado en tiempo real y reducir el tiempo de resolución de incidencias.


Supervisa y gestiona tus pedidos

GelatoConnect te ofrece varias herramientas para que gestiones tus pedidos de forma eficaz:

  • Página de solicitudes: Consulta los pedidos que llegan y filtra por estado.

  • Gestión de pedidos: Busca tus pedidos y realiza acciones como cancelar o volver a procesar.

  • Análisis de pedidos: Controla el volumen de pedidos, las tasas de error y las tendencias.


¿Deseas saber más?

Para que lo tengas aún más claro y todo funcione sobre ruedas:

¿Ha quedado contestada tu pregunta?